FAST EDDY’S PELLET COOKER MODEL PG500 GENERAL INSTRUCTIONS This unit must be electrically grounded in accordance to your local codes, or with the National Electrical Code ANSI/NFPA 70-1990. Best to plug into a single plug surge protector. Keep the cooker free from combustible materials. Maintain a minimum clearance of 12” from front, back and sides. Never store or use gasoline or other flammable materials in the vicinity of this cooker or use to ignite fuel for this cooker.
Shut down procedure: Turn switch to the off position. ELECTRICAL SPECIFICATIONS 110 Volt, 60 Hz, single phase, 4 amp service required All switches should be in the off position before plugging into proper receptacle outlet The fire pot igniter elements are 200 watts; the auger motor and burner induction fan are 25 watts each.
Insure the fire diffuser is in place over the fire pot and the drip tray is in the proper position under the indirect cooking grill. Place the drain bucket on the retaining clip under the drain tube. Place both grills in their proper position and follow the operating instructions listed below. OPERATING INSTRUCTIONS During first firing turn switch on and set the temp to 400 degrees. The ignitor will stay on until the cooker gets to 140 degrees.
If your grill is going out, we recommend raising the LHt by ½ second or .5 which will change the setting from 10 to 15. Different brands and flavors of pellets will produce different BTU output. It may not be unusual to make this small change.

TWO YEAR LIMITED WARRANTY Fast Eddy by Cookshack Pellet Cookers are guaranteed to be free from defects in material and workmanship, under normal use and when installed in accordance with factory recommendations. Fast Eddy by Cookshack Pellet Cooker’s limited warranty includes parts for two (2) years and labor for the first 90 days of this period.
You assume the risk of any loss or damage that occurs during transit due to improper packaging of the returned merchandise. Use the original container that the merchandise was shipped in or equivalent. Repair or replacement of merchandise under warranty Replacement or repairing defective merchandise is at Cookshack, Inc.'s option. If repair of merchandise is deemed necessary by Cookshack, Inc. you will be instructed as to the necessary arrangements in order to affect the repair of the merchandise.
